Potensi ekologis dan pola sebaran teripang Holothuria scabra dan Holothuria vagabunda di Perairan Tanjungkeramat Desa Pangkil, Kabupaten Bintan, Indonesia Rani Marni; Febrianti Lestari; Susiana Susiana

Abstract

The aim of the study was to determine the ecological potential and pattern of the distribution of sea cucumbers in the waters of Tanjungkeramat, Pangkil Village, Teluk Bintan District, Bintan regency. This study uses a survey method, determining the area with a swap area method of 4 areas, measuring the area using a meter with a length and width of 100 x 50 m. The results of the study found 2 types. Sea cucumber from the subfamily namely Holothuriidae and Stichopodidae. The highest density of Holothuroidea species in area I is 46 individual/ha. The lowest density is in area IV which is 12 individual/ha. Sea cucumber density in Tanjungkeramat is still relatively good. The water conditions in Tanjungkeramat still meet the quality standards that support the life of sea cucumber. Distribution pattern in area I with Id value 0.69, area II with Id value 0.68, and area III with a value of 0.42 has an even distribution pattern, while the distribution pattern in area IV Id 1.00 has a random distribution pattern.
Kondisi dan pola pemanfaatan siput gonggong di Perairan Pulau Penyengat Kecamatan Tanjungpinang Kota, Kepulauan Riau, Indonesia Raja Wira Pradana; Febrianti Lestari; Susiana Susiana

Abstract

This study aims to determine the conditions and patterns of utilization of snails in the Penyengat island waters, Riau Island, Indonesia. The method used was purposive sampling of 5 stations with 70 x 2 m quadratic transect for the density of the Gonggong Snail. The results found two types of snail bark species namely Laevistrombus turturella and Strombus urceus with a total density value of 0.114individual per m². The use of snail bark patterns in Penyengat Island waters, namely the size of the catch is medium to large, manual capture techniques (collected by hand), the catching area in the waters of the island is 100-200 m from the beach, the most catches found >100 individuals, season and time of catching snail barks at stinging island waters are not based on season, utilization and distribution of utilization. The snail bark resource is used for consumption and sold to collectors.

The rate of regeneration of mangrove ecosystems on post-bauxite mining areas in the waters of Sei Carang, Tanjungpinang City Moza Fani Maylani; Febrianti Lestari; Susiana Susiana

Abstract

The mangrove ecosystem in the Sei Carang estuary waters, Tanjungpinang city is a mangrove ecosystem that has land conversion activities and leaves the environment with open land. The purpose of this study was to determine the density and regeneration rate of mangrove ecosystems on post-bauxite mining areas as seen from seedling, sapling, and trees. This research was conducted in July-October 2022. This study was conducted at four stations determined by the purposive sampling method, based on the existence of a mangrove ecosystem in which there are post-bauxite mine openings in the Sei Carang estuary waters, Tanjungpinang City. For each station, 3 plots of data were collected, with a plot size of 1x1m for the seedling category, a plot of 5x5m for sampling and a plot of 10x10m for trees. Data analysis used the formula for species density, for the regeneration rate by comparing the data from the calculation of the density of seedling, sapling and trees and then the formula for the diversity index. The results of the study found eight types of mangroves, namely Rhizophora apiculata, Rhizophora mucronata, Bruguiera gymnorhiza, Soneratia alba, Avicennia lanata, Nypa fruticans, and Lumnitzera litorea. Density values at station 1 for seedling 40,000 individual/Ha, sapling 2,667 individual/Ha, and trees 1,533 individual/Ha, at station 2 for seedling 30,000 individual/Ha, sapling 1,467 individual/Ha, and trees 500 individual/Ha, at station 3 for seedling 36,667 individual/Ha, sapling 5,200 individual/Ha, and trees 1,600 individual/Ha then at station 4 for seedling 53,333 individual/Ha, sapling 3,200 individual/Ha, and trees 2,133 individual/Ha. The level of mangrove regeneration at all observation stations is quite good.

Mangrove litter production in Sei Carang waters of Tanjungpinang City, Riau Island Province Urai Dian Dharma Putra; Febrianti Lestari; Susiana Susiana

Abstract

Sei Carang waters are a mangrove ecosystem area with a fairly wide area coverage, Sei Carang waters have mangrove ecosystems. This study aims to determine the level of mangrove density and production of mangrove litter in Sei Carang. This research was conducted May-June 2022 located in Sei Carang. Observation locations were determined by survey methods and point selection using purposive sampling. Then observations using line transects using a plot measuring 10x10 m. There were 6 species found at the study site, namely: Rhizophora apiculata, Rhizophora mucronata, Bruguiera gymnorhiza, Bruguiera sexangula, Sonneratia alba, Xylocarpus granatum. The most common types were found at station 1 where there were 6 of them, and at station 3 there were only 4 types. With density levels ranging from 1633.33 ind/ha to 2300 ind/ha. And also the highest litter production value occurs at station 3 with an average value of 7.21 (gbk/m2) and the lowest occurs at station 2 with an average value of 2.27 (gbk/m2), and the parameters of the Sei Carang waters are still relatively low. good for the life of the mangrove ecosystem when compared to seawater Quality Standards Government Regulation of the Republic of Indonesia No. 22 of 2021 concerning the Implementation of Environmental Protection and Management, Attachment VII.
Status of mangrove ecosystems in the waters of Senggarang Besar, Tanjungpinang City, Riau Islands Province Muzadid Salam; Febrianti Lestari; Susiana Susiana

Abstract

The waters of Senggarang Besar are located in Senggarang Village, Tanjungpinang Kota District. The waters of Senggarang Besar have a fairly large mangrove ecosystem plus many mangrove seedling planting activities in the coastal waters of Senggarang Besar. Mangrove ecosystems have a variety of natural resources that are abundant and diverse. Mangroves are the most potential ecosystems because mangroves support the diversity of flora and fauna in aquatic communities and play a significant role in human survival based on economic, community and environmental perspectives. This study aims to determine the density, canopy cover, and status of mangrove ecosystems in the waters of Senggarang Besar. This research was conducted in September-December 2022 located in the waters of Senggarang Besar Tanjungpinang City, Riau Islands Province. Determination of observation stations using direct survey method in the field with 3 station points with 6 plots at each station, based on the presence of mangrove ecosystems. Determination of the retrieval point using purposive sampling method. Mangarove ecosystem species found in the waters of Senggarang Besar Tanjungpinang City Riau Islands Province there are 4 species including: Rhizophora apiculata, Bruguiera gymnorhiza, Xylocarpus granatum, and Avicenia marina. With density and cover values at station 1, 3900 ind/ha and 81.00%, at station 2, 1433.33 ind/ha and 69.98%, and station 3, 1446.7 ind/ha and 69.08%. The level of damage to the mangrove ecosystem in the waters of Senggarang Besar Tanjungpinang City, Riau Islands Province at station 1 includes good, very dense criteria based on KepMen LH No. 201 of 2004. While at stations 2 and 3 the level of damage includes good, moderate criteria based on KepMen LH No. 201 Year 2004.
